Heatless Hair Elongation

Meaning ❉ “Heatless Hair Elongation” refers to the artful practice of extending the apparent length of coily and kinky hair textures without reliance on thermal tools. This method, deeply rooted in a nuanced understanding of textured hair’s unique structural memory and elasticity, offers a gentle pathway to revealing its true growth potential. For individuals with Black and mixed-race hair, where natural curl patterns often create a perceived shortening, this systematic approach becomes a foundational principle of length retention. Through thoughtful implementation of techniques like strategic banding, precise twists, or carefully sectioned braids, one can guide damp strands to air-dry in an attenuated state. This not only mitigates shrinkage, a common characteristic of highly coiled hair, but also serves as a protective measure against the very real risks of heat-induced damage. The practical application of such methods transforms daily routines into an intentional system, fostering consistency in hair care and allowing for the visual celebration of accumulated length. It stands as a gentle declaration of the hair’s inherent capacity for growth, offering both protective styling and a clear view of its beautiful, uncoiled form.
